Fayezeh Ghavimi is a scholar working on Electrical and Electronic Engineering, Aerospace Engineering and Computer Vision and Pattern Recognition. According to data from OpenAlex, Fayezeh Ghavimi has authored 7 papers receiving a total of 293 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Electrical and Electronic Engineering, 3 papers in Aerospace Engineering and 2 papers in Computer Vision and Pattern Recognition. Recurrent topics in Fayezeh Ghavimi’s work include Advanced MIMO Systems Optimization (4 papers), UAV Applications and Optimization (3 papers) and IoT Networks and Protocols (2 papers). Fayezeh Ghavimi is often cited by papers focused on Advanced MIMO Systems Optimization (4 papers), UAV Applications and Optimization (3 papers) and IoT Networks and Protocols (2 papers). Fayezeh Ghavimi collaborates with scholars based in Finland, Taiwan and Sweden. Fayezeh Ghavimi's co-authors include Hsiao‐Hwa Chen, Riku Jäntti, Mustafa Özger, Çiçek Çavdar, Amin Azari and Kalle Ruttik and has published in prestigious journals such as IEEE Communications Surveys & Tutorials, IEEE Transactions on Vehicular Technology and Aaltodoc (Aalto University).
